County Employee Sentencing Scheduled For Sept. 26

A former Franklin County Highway Department Supervisor and former County Commissioner candidate has pleaded guilty to one count fraudulent use of a credit device in Franklin County Court, Aug. 29.

Jefferey E. Thurmond, Sullivan, appeared before Judge Gael Wood, entering a guilty plea to the one felony count with two counts of forgery being dropped following the one guilty plea.

Thurmond is believed to have used a county credit card to make purchase of around $13,000 from 2013-2016 stating that they were for county highway projects, but in fact were for personal use, following an audit and investigation by the Missouri Highway Patrol in late 2016.

Thurmond is scheduled to appear before Judge Gael Wood on September 26, at 1:30 p.m. for formal sentencing with 120 days of incarceration in the Missouri Department of Corrections expected along with four years probation.
